ERIE, Pa. – The Lock Haven University women's soccer team (4-8-0, 3-8-0 PSAC) dropped a very close road match against Mercyhurst (4-6-2, 3-6-2 PSAC) 1-0 in overtime.
The Bald Eagles and the Lakers played a scoreless first 90 minutes with both teams playing tremendous defense and doing everything they could to keep the other team out of the attacking third of the field.
Once the overtime period hit, Mercyhurst was able to make just one more play than the Haven and capitalized on a scoring chance in the 97
th minute to seal the win.
The Bald Eagles used a balanced offensive attack against the Lakers, receiving five shots on goal from five different players.
Jordan Shoff (York, Pa./York Suburban) and
Carly Spinuzza (Williamstown, N.J./Williamstown) led Lock Haven with two shots each.
Goalkeeper
Bree Hilty (Lock Haven, Pa./Central Mountain) was great in goal for the Haven, recording five saves and leading the Bald Eagle defense as they held Mercyhurst scoreless for 96 minutes.
